South African Exchange Visa – Work and Learn in South Africa

The South African Exchange Visa allows foreign nationals to participate in work experience or cultural exchange programs in South Africa. Moving South Immigration specialises in assisting exchange participants through the application process, ensuring compliance and smooth approval.

Introduction

The South African Exchange Visa is intended for foreign nationals who want to gain professional experience, develop skills, or participate in cultural exchange programs in South Africa. This visa is ideal for interns, trainees, researchers, and participants in recognised exchange programs, providing an opportunity to experience South African work environments, industries, and culture firsthand.

 

South Africa welcomes skilled individuals and young professionals from around the world, and the Exchange Visa helps foster international collaboration, knowledge sharing, and bilateral relationships. Requirements

Applicants must provide the following to apply for an Exchange Visa:

  • A valid passport valid for no less than 30 days after intended departure from the Republic and at least two (2) blank pages

  • Sponsorship from a recognised South African institution or organisation

  • Proof of qualifications or experience relevant to the exchange program

  • Sufficient funds to support your stay in South Africa

  • Medical and police clearance certificates

  • Medical Insurance or Cover (where applicable)

  • Compliance with Department of Home Affairs documentation requirements

Processing Time & What to Expect

Processing Time:

  • 4–8 weeks, depending on sponsorship verification and documentation completeness

 

What to Expect:

  • Submit a complete application with all supporting documents

  • Department of Home Affairs verifies sponsorship and eligibility

  • Temporary visa is issued for the duration of the exchange program

  • Entry and exit are subject to South African border control regulations
